The Simple Answer: Does Subway Accept EBT?

This is the big question! **As of right now, the answer is generally no, Subway restaurants in Oregon do not accept EBT cards.** This means you won’t be able to use your SNAP (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program) benefits to pay for your sandwich. There are some exceptions to this, though.

Understanding Restaurant Meal Programs

Sometimes, there are special Restaurant Meal Programs (RMPs) that could change things. These programs allow certain people, like the elderly, people with disabilities, or those experiencing homelessness, to use their EBT cards to buy prepared meals at restaurants. But this is a state and local government level decision.

Unfortunately, Oregon does not have a statewide RMP at the time of this writing. This means that people cannot generally use their EBT cards at restaurants.
